Overview

Datature is a computer vision platform founded in Singapore in December 2019 by Keechin Goh (CEO), Denzel Lee (CTO), and Mackenzie Chng, initially operating under the name SEER Analytics before adopting the Datature brand within its first year. The company has raised $2.7 million from investors including Openspace Capital and January Capital.

Datature takes labeled image or video data and turns it into production computer vision models without requiring a team to write custom training code, covering annotation (including an AI-assisted IntelliBrush tool), dataset versioning, model training against architectures like YOLOv8, and deployment. Over 6,000 teams across healthcare, retail, smart cities, agriculture, and manufacturing use the platform to build detection and classification models.

Datature fits teams that need production computer vision (defect detection, inventory counting, safety monitoring) but lack a dedicated ML engineering group to build the pipeline from scratch. A free Developer tier covers individuals and small projects; the Professional plan runs $299/month on annual billing (or $499/month paid monthly), and Enterprise pricing is scoped per project count, data volume, and support level.

Pros & cons

Pros

  • Covers the full computer vision pipeline (label, train, deploy) in one platform rather than stitching tools together
  • Free Developer tier gives a real path to try the platform before committing budget
  • 6,000+ teams across varied industries suggest the tooling generalizes beyond one niche
  • No-code annotation and training lower the bar for teams without dedicated ML engineers

Cons

  • Professional plan jumps to $499/month on monthly billing if a team is not ready to commit annually
  • No-code training trades some flexibility that a custom-coded pipeline would give experienced ML teams
  • Enterprise pricing and support-level details require a direct conversation rather than transparent self-serve tiers
  • Smaller funding base ($2.7M) than some computer-vision competitors, worth weighing for long-term platform risk
